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School: frequently asked questions
Is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School's water safe to drink?
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School is an active non-transient non-community water system regulated under the Safe Drinking Water Act, overseen by the FL state drinking water program. EPA SDWA violation and enforcement records for this system are being added to AquaCensus from EPA ECHO; consult EPA ECHO or your annual Consumer Confidence Report for its current compliance status.
Who runs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School?
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School (PWSID FL5364148) is a private-owned non-transient non-community water system, regulated by the FL state drinking water program.
How many people does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School serve?
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School reports serving 70 people through 2 service connections in Lee County, Florida.
Where does Gunnery Road Baptist Church and School get its water?
E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as groundwater.
